Job Description Figure Skating Director & Assistant Manager Reports To: General Manager Position Type: Full-Time, Salaried Location: Vacaville Ice Sports, 551 Davis St. Vacaville, CA Position Summary The Figure Skating Director & Assistant Manager is a dual-role leadership position responsible for overseeing all aspects of the Skating Academy, camps, coaches, teams, competitions, and daily office operations. This position ensures a high-quality experience for skaters, families, staff, and coaches by combining program management expertise with strong administrative leadership. The ideal candidate is strategic, highly organized, and hands-on, capable of growing long-term figure skating programs while efficiently managing day-to-day business operations. K E Y R E S P O N S I B I L I T I E S Skating Academy Leadership & Instruction • Design, implement, and refine a comprehensive skating curriculum for all ages and skill levels., • Lead and mentor instructors by providing training, lesson plan support, and regular performance evaluations., • Track student progress through assessments, ribbons, and progress reports; communicate advancement recommendations to families., • Conduct individual development meetings with parents and skaters to discuss future skating pathways and program options. Manage all Academy registration, cancellations, credits, transfers, make-ups, and customer service needs. • Print rosters, monitor attendance, supervise Academy sessions (Tues/Thurs/Sat), and step in to teach as needed. Develop creative strategies to expand Academy enrollment and strengthen pipelines into advanced programs, teams, and camps. Skating Camp Oversight & Execution • Plan, coordinate, and execute skating camps, including daily schedules, lesson plans, staffing, and rosters., • Recruit, train, and supervise camp instructors and support staff with ongoing feedback and performance management., • Create engaging and age-appropriate programs for all camp levels, including specialty camps for advanced skaters., • Manage all registration tasks, including parent communication, last-minute signups, transfers, and cancellations., • Maintain camp-related budgets, equipment inventory, craft materials, loaner gear, and ensure spaces remain organized and clean., • Develop creative program enhancements to increase enrollment and convert camp families into Academy skaters, competitors, and NorCal Elite skating team members. Coaching Staff Management • Oversee coaching operations and ensure accurate, timely calculation and payment of commissions., • Maintain complete and up-to-date employment records, including insurance, SafeSport, ISI credentials, and contracts., • Provide training, continuing education, and performance guidance to maintain high coaching standards., • Coordinate scheduling across Academy, camps, private lessons, competitions, and special rink events., • Manage time-off requests and develop staffing plans to ensure adequate coverage., • Foster a professional, team-focused environment emphasizing accountability, consistency, and growth. NorCal Elite Team Administration (Synchro & Theatre on Ice) • Manage all administrative operations for NorCal Elite teams, including rosters, schedules, communications, and team materials., • Oversee team finances: track team dues, collect payments, process coach payouts, manage expenses, and issue reimbursements promptly., • Maintain detailed financial records including receipts, budgets, outstanding balances, and payment histories., • Create and distribute team contracts, payment plans, season packets, and annual informational materials., • Complete all competition registrations accurately and on time., • Collaborate with coaches and management to maintain clear expectations, improve processes, and support team performance throughout the season. Competition & Show Management • Plan and execute all figure skating competitions and shows (Ice Sports Champs, Solano Showcase, Cowtown Classic, Skate a Gift)., • Secure sanctioning/endorsement, update announcements, manage pricing, and set up registration in EntryEeze., • Coordinate event logistics including schedules, skate orders, judges’ assignments, coach credentials, zamboni schedules, medals, trophies, decor, and equipment., • Partner with marketing and management to promote events and increase participation., • Manage all competitor communication, payments, refunds, music collection, and registration changes., • Lead the setup and breakdown of event stations and ensure adequate staffing and volunteer support., • Actively manage operations during events, ensuring smooth flow and quick resolution of issues., • Balance minimal coaching obligations during competitions to maintain full operational focus. Management & Administrative Leadership • Oversee daily office operations, including staffing, training, scheduling, and customer service., • Train and supervise floor staff to ensure consistent, professional communication and policy compliance., • Create and implement new public skate programming such as games, mascot appearances and general announcements., • Maintain organized administrative systems including filing, financial logs, contracts, and operational records., • Handle facility communications: email, phone, in-person inquiries, internal messages, and customer concerns., • Ensure compliance with labor laws, company policies, and safety procedures., • Assist with hiring, onboarding, evaluations, and performance improvement for staff., • Prepare reports, track attendance, and support administrative tasks for programs, rentals, public sessions, and events., • Collaborate with leadership to enhance operational efficiency, team culture, and long-term planning. Pro Shop Liaison • Assist with figure skate fittings and customer consultations., • Collaborate with the Pro Shop Manager on inventory adjustments and product recommendations., • Train staff on figure skating equipment needs and fitting basics to improve customer service and sales. Marketing & Program Growth Collaboration • Partner with the social media coordinator to promote all figure skating programs., • Create strategies to maximize enrollment through digital marketing, print materials, community outreach, and parent engagement., • Research and implement improvements to program offerings and customer experience. Additional Requirements • Serve as a positive role model for all staff, coaches, and skaters., • Support special projects, strategic initiatives, and cross-functional programs as assigned., • Maintain a clean, organized, and efficient work environment., • Must be available during Academy sessions, skate camps, and throughout the week for office hours and program oversight., • Availability full time Tuesday through Saturday, with some modifications to this weekly schedule based on events and competitions. Q U A L I F I C A T I O N S • Extensive figure skating background, preferably with coaching, directing, or competitive experience., • Proven leadership, program management, and staff supervision experience., • Strong communication, organizational, and time-management skills., • Familiarity with ISI (required) and USFS (optional) standards, certifications, and competition operations., • Current SafeSport compliance, background check, and ISI certification required., • Proficiency in office software, scheduling systems, and digital communication tools., • Ability to work a flexible schedule including evenings, weekends, and holidays (Closed Easter, Thanksgiving, and Christmas Day)., • CPR/First Aid certification preferred.
